When thinking of sneakers that released in 1991, one usually pinpoints two Swoosh classics in the Air Jordan 6 and the Nike Air Huarache, but the year was loaded with a number of other releases that are set to get the retro treatment 23 years later. Bo Jackson’s sneakers are as dominant in the retro category today as the man was on both the baseball diamond and football field in his prime. His Nike Air Max Trainer ’91 has readily donned a few colorways here and there this year (although 2013 served as a nice revamping year as the shoe returned in a Raiders and Eagles aesthetic to help usher in Nike’s merchandising rights). This Black/University Red look isn’t as loud as past views – think of the shoe randomly taking on a South Beach colorway – and the “Chicago”-esque treatment showcases the silhouette quite nicely.
